Rumors are swirling about Apple's next major iPhone launch, potentially dubbed the 'iPhone Ultra.' The most talked-about feature is a foldable design that could be as thin as a passport, offering a large internal screen that unfolds for productivity. This would be a significant shift from current iPhones, which remain rigid. Investors are watching closely to see if Apple can successfully integrate this new form factor without sacrificing durability or battery life.

This potential device matters to the broader market because it signals Apple's continued push into premium hardware innovation. A successful launch could boost investor sentiment towards the tech sector and set a new standard for foldable smartphones. However, the high development costs and potential manufacturing challenges mean the stock impact will depend on how well the device is received by consumers.

What to watch next is the official announcement from Apple. Investors should pay attention to the device's actual specifications, such as the processing power and battery efficiency, rather than just the foldable gimmick. The market will also be looking for Apple's roadmap regarding how this new device fits into its existing product lineup and pricing strategy.
